    “Nettles”

    Hayden Anhedönia has been making music beneath the title Ethel Cain since 2019. Nevertheless it’s not only a band title or a moniker; Ethel Cain is a fictional character, a kind of alter ego that Hayden’s been creating and world constructing round all through her albums. The primary Ethel Cain album, Preacher’s Daughter, got here out in 2022. It ended up blowing up, and it made Hayden the primary overtly trans artist with an album within the top ten on the Billboard chart. In 2025, she put out the second Ethel Cain album, referred to as Willoughby Tucker, I’ll Always Love You. For this episode, I talked to Hayden about how she made the music “Nettles.” As you’re about to listen to, it took on a number of completely different varieties, over a number of years, earlier than she received to the ultimate model.
